Alarm n Value

w

The Alarm n activation point

– The value is limited by the scaled input limits

for Process High; Process Low; PV-SP Deviation (+ve above, -ve below
setpoint), Band (above or below setpoint) type alarms.
Rate of Signal Change is a rate of 0.0 to 99999 (rate in units per minute).
Memory used, Control Power High, Control Power Low are 0.0 to 100.0%

not required for Control Loop or Input Signal Break alarm types.

Alarm n Hysteresis

The

deadband on the “safe” side of alarm n, through which signal must

pass before alarm deactivates - not for Rate of Change, Control Loop,
Input Break or Percentage of Memory used alarms.

Alarm n Minimum
Duration

w The minimum time that alarm n must be passed its threshold before

activating (deactivation is not affected by this parameter). Adjustable from
0.0 to 9999.0 secs.

not used for signal break, memory or loop alarms.

Caution:

If the duration is less than the time set, the alarm will not

become active.

Alarm n Inhibit

w If the inhibit is enabled, it prevents the initial alarm activation if the alarm

condition is true at power up. Activation only occurs once the alarm
condition has passed and then reoccurred.

Control n Loop
Alarm Type

w Sets the loop alarm time source, from: Manual Loop Alarm Time (as set in

the loop alarm n time screen) or Automatic (twice the integral time constant
setting
). If configured, a Loop Alarm activates if no response is seen in loop
n after this time following the saturation of its power output.

Only seen if

an alarm is set for control loop type.

Control n Loop
Alarm Time

w The time (max 99:59 mm:ss) for loop n to begin responding after PID

power output reaches saturation, if a manual loop alarm type is configured.

COMMUNICATIONS CONFIGURATION SUB-MENU SCREENS

No Communications
Warning

If Communications Configuration menu is entered without a

communications module fitted.

Modbus Parity

The setting for Modbus comms parity bit checking, from: Odd; Even or

None. Set the same parity for all devices on the network

Only seen if

RS485 or Ethernet communications option is fitted.

Modbus Data Rate

The setting for the Modbus comms data speed. From: 4800; 9600; 19200;

38400; 57600 or 115200 bps. Set the same speed for all devices on the
network

Only seen if RS485 or Ethernet communications option is fitted.

Master Mode, or
Slave Address

Slave address (1 to 255), or multi-zone Setpoint Master Mode

Only seen

if RS485 or Ethernet communications option is fitted, but Master mode is
not available over Ethernet.

Target Register In
Slave

Target memory register for the setpoint value in attached slave controllers.

All slaves must have the same setpoint register address as set here -
Appears only if unit is in Master mode.

Master Mode Format The data format required by the attached setpoint slaves. From: Integer;

integer with 1 decimal place or float - Appears only if unit is in Master
mode.

Serial
Communications
Write Enable

Enables/disables writing via RS485 or Ethernet communications.

When disabled, parameters can be read, but attempts to change their
values over comms are blocked.
